深入解析1717c08.cpp,探索其编程结构与实现逻辑

展开

深入解析1717c08.cpp,探索其编程结构与实现逻辑

作者:蔡美慧

不要放词用不到可以当备用标签今日监管部门披露重大进展

89万字| 连载| 2026-05-29 02:39:57 更新

在软件开发的广阔天地中,每一个文件都承载着特定的功能与逻辑,如同构成复杂机器的精密零件。今天,我们将目光聚焦于一个名为“1717C08.CPP”的源代码文件。这个文件名本身可能并不起眼,但它很可能是一个C++项目中的关键组成部分,其内部蕴含着开发者为实现特定功能而精心设计的算法与数据结构。本文旨在深入剖析此类CPP文件的一般性结构、编程范式及其在项目中的潜在角色,以帮助读者更好地理解C++编程实践。 首先,从文件名“1717C08.CPP”我们可以进行初步推断。扩展名“.CPP”明确标识了这是一份C++语言的源代码文件。C++作为一种高效、灵活且功能强大的编程语言,广泛应用于系统软件、游戏开发、高性能服务器以及嵌入式系统等领域。文件名中的“1717C08”部分,可能是一个内部的项目编号、模块标识、日期代码,或是代表某个特定功能的缩写。在实际的开发环境中,这样的命名有助于开发团队对大量源代码文件进行有序的管理和快速的定位。 接下来,让我们探讨一个典型的“1717C08.CPP”文件可能具备的基本结构。一份组织良好的C++源文件通常包含以下几个部分: 文件头注释是必不可少的开端。它一般会包含版权声明、作者信息、创建与修改日期、文件描述以及版本历史。对于“1717C08.CPP”而言,这里的描述可能会阐明该文件的核心目的,例如:“实现XX数据处理模块的核心算法”或“定义与YY硬件通信的接口类”。这部分内容虽不参与程序运行,但对于代码的维护和团队协作至关重要。 紧接着是预处理指令。最常见的便是`#include`指令,用于引入必要的头文件。这些头文件可能来自C++标准库(如``, ``, ``),也可能是项目内的自定义头文件(如`“1717C08.h”`)。如果“1717C08.CPP”是一个实现文件,那么它极有可能包含其对应的头文件`“1717C08.h”`,该头文件中通常声明了需要在外部使用的类、函数和变量,而“1717C08.CPP”则负责这些声明的具体实现。此外,还可能包含条件编译指令(如`#ifdef`, `#define`),用于实现跨平台兼容或功能开关。 文件的主体部分,即命名空间和代码实现,是“1717C08.CPP”的灵魂所在。开发者可能会将代码封装在特定的命名空间(例如`namespace Project1717C08`)中,以避免全局作用域下的名称冲突。在此之内,便是各种功能的实现: 其一,可能是类的实现。如果“1717C08.CPP”对应一个类,那么这里将包含该类所有成员函数(包括构造函数、析构函数)的具体定义。这些函数实现了对象的初始化、业务逻辑、资源释放等行为。 其二,可能是全局函数或工具函数的实现。这些函数提供独立的功能服务,供项目中的其他模块调用。 其三,还可能包含全局或静态变量的定义,以及一些辅助性的宏或内联函数。 在逻辑层面,“1717C08.CPP”所实现的功能可以是多种多样的。它可能是一个复杂算法的载体,比如一个高效的排序或搜索例程;也可能是一个驱动模块,负责与特定的外部设备(编号或许隐含了设备型号)进行数据交互;又或者,它实现了一个网络通信协议中的关键解析步骤。其代码质量通常体现在算法的效率、资源的妥善管理(遵循RAII原则)、异常安全性的处理以及代码的可读性和可维护性上。 最后,理解“1717C08.CPP”绝不能脱离其项目上下文。它必然与项目中的其他文件(如头文件、库文件、配置文件)存在紧密的依赖和调用关系。通过构建系统(如CMake、Makefile),它被编译成目标代码,并最终链接成为可执行程序或动态库的一部分,发挥其作用。 综上所述,尽管我们无法窥见“1717C08.CPP”文件的具体代码行,但通过分析其命名规范、结构要素和C++编程的最佳实践,我们可以清晰地勾勒出它在软件项目中的典型形象。它代表了一种模块化、结构化的编程思想,是开发者将抽象需求转化为具体、可执行指令的成果。每一个像“1717C08.CPP”这样的文件,都是构建数字化世界这座宏伟大厦的坚实砖瓦,其内部的逻辑与严谨的结构,共同保障了软件系统的稳定与高效运行。

立即阅读 目录

热度: 36215

相关推荐

目录 · 共210章

深入解析1717c08.cpp,探索其编程结构与实现逻辑·共93章 免费

深入解析1717c08.cpp,探索其编程结构与实现逻辑·共84章 VIP

深入解析1717c08.cpp,探索其编程结构与实现逻辑·共20章 VIP

正文

第1章:深入解析1717c08.cpp,探索其编程结构与实现逻辑

在软件开发的广阔天地中,每一个文件都承载着特定的功能与逻辑,如同构成复杂机器的精密零件。今天,我们将目光聚焦于一个名为“1717C08.CPP”的源代码文件。这个文件名本身可能并不起眼,但它很可能是一个C++项目中的关键组成部分,其内部蕴含着开发者为实现特定功能而精心设计的算法与数据结构。本文旨在深入剖析此类CPP文件的一般性结构、编程范式及其在项目中的潜在角色,以帮助读者更好地理解C++编程实践。 首先,从文件名“1717C08.CPP”我们可以进行初步推断。扩展名“.CPP”明确标识了这是一份C++语言的源代码文件。C++作为一种高效、灵活且功能强大的编程语言,广泛应用于系统软件、游戏开发、高性能服务器以及嵌入式系统等领域。文件名中的“1717C08”部分,可能是一个内部的项目编号、模块标识、日期代码,或是代表某个特定功能的缩写。在实际的开发环境中,这样的命名有助于开发团队对大量源代码文件进行有序的管理和快速的定位。 接下来,让我们探讨一个典型的“1717C08.CPP”文件可能具备的基本结构。一份组织良好的C++源文件通常包含以下几个部分: 文件头注释是必不可少的开端。它一般会包含版权声明、作者信息、创建与修改日期、文件描述以及版本历史。对于“1717C08.CPP”而言,这里的描述可能会阐明该文件的核心目的,例如:“实现XX数据处理模块的核心算法”或“定义与YY硬件通信的接口类”。这部分内容虽不参与程序运行,但对于代码的维护和团队协作至关重要。 紧接着是预处理指令。最常见的便是`#include`指令,用于引入必要的头文件。这些头文件可能来自C++标准库(如``, ``, ``),也可能是项目内的自定义头文件(如`“1717C08.h”`)。如果“1717C08.CPP”是一个实现文件,那么它极有可能包含其对应的头文件`“1717C08.h”`,该头文件中通常声明了需要在外部使用的类、函数和变量,而“1717C08.CPP”则负责这些声明的具体实现。此外,还可能包含条件编译指令(如`#ifdef`, `#define`),用于实现跨平台兼容或功能开关。 文件的主体部分,即命名空间和代码实现,是“1717C08.CPP”的灵魂所在。开发者可能会将代码封装在特定的命名空间(例如`namespace Project1717C08`)中,以避免全局作用域下的名称冲突。在此之内,便是各种功能的实现: 其一,可能是类的实现。如果“1717C08.CPP”对应一个类,那么这里将包含该类所有成员函数(包括构造函数、析构函数)的具体定义。这些函数实现了对象的初始化、业务逻辑、资源释放等行为。 其二,可能是全局函数或工具函数的实现。这些函数提供独立的功能服务,供项目中的其他模块调用。 其三,还可能包含全局或静态变量的定义,以及一些辅助性的宏或内联函数。 在逻辑层面,“1717C08.CPP”所实现的功能可以是多种多样的。它可能是一个复杂算法的载体,比如一个高效的排序或搜索例程;也可能是一个驱动模块,负责与特定的外部设备(编号或许隐含了设备型号)进行数据交互;又或者,它实现了一个网络通信协议中的关键解析步骤。其代码质量通常体现在算法的效率、资源的妥善管理(遵循RAII原则)、异常安全性的处理以及代码的可读性和可维护性上。 最后,理解“1717C08.CPP”绝不能脱离其项目上下文。它必然与项目中的其他文件(如头文件、库文件、配置文件)存在紧密的依赖和调用关系。通过构建系统(如CMake、Makefile),它被编译成目标代码,并最终链接成为可执行程序或动态库的一部分,发挥其作用。 综上所述,尽管我们无法窥见“1717C08.CPP”文件的具体代码行,但通过分析其命名规范、结构要素和C++编程的最佳实践,我们可以清晰地勾勒出它在软件项目中的典型形象。它代表了一种模块化、结构化的编程思想,是开发者将抽象需求转化为具体、可执行指令的成果。每一个像“1717C08.CPP”这样的文件,都是构建数字化世界这座宏伟大厦的坚实砖瓦,其内部的逻辑与严谨的结构,共同保障了软件系统的稳定与高效运行。

阅读全文

更多推荐